Why This Matters

This bill makes sure that nursing aide training programs meet higher standards to provide better care for seniors. It helps ensure that only qualified aides are allowed to work in nursing facilities.

If you have a loved one in a nursing facility, this bill could lead to better care from trained aides.
Who this affects
Seniors in nursing facilities · Aides caring for seniors
What changes is this bill making?
  1. 1This bill changes rules for training programs for nursing aides in skilled nursing facilities.
  2. 2It ensures that only qualified programs receive approval under Medicare and Medicaid.
  3. 3The bill aims to improve the quality of care for seniors in these facilities.
  4. 4It sets stricter standards for facilities that have faced penalties or quality issues.
  5. 5The bill affects both Medicare and Medicaid programs.
